What is N3I8 chemical compound name?

Chemistry
1 answer:
joja [24]3 years ago
8 0

Answer:

When naming molecular compounds prefixes are used to dictate the number of a given element present in the compound. ” mono-” indicates one, “di-” indicates two, “tri-” is three, “tetra-” is four, “penta-” is five, and “hexa-” is six, “hepta-” is seven, “octo-” is eight, “nona-” is nine, and “deca” is ten.

A sample of seawater contains 1.3g of calcium ions in 3,100kg of solution. what is the calcium ion concentration of this solutio
MakcuM [25]
Unit ppm stands for parts per million. in terms of mass, ppm is equivalent to mg/kg.
since 1 kg is 10⁻⁶ mg, 1 kg is equivalent to million mg.
therefore mg/kg is also ppm.
there are 1.3 g of Ca ions in 3100 kg
if 3100 kg contains - 1.3 g of Ca
then 1 kg contains - 1.3 g / 3100 kg
then Ca ions - 0.42 x 10⁻³ g/kg
Ca ion concentration - 0.42 mg/kg 
therefore Ca ion concentration is 0.42 ppm

Find the mass of a 50.p ml quantity of liquid of liquid is 1.64 g/ml
scoray [572]

Answer:

The mass of liquid comes out to be 82 g.

Explanation:

Given density of liquid = 1.64 g/mL

Given volume of liquid = 50 mL

The relation between density and volume is shown below

\textrm{ Density} = \frac{\textrm{Mass of liquid}}{\textrm{ Volume of liquid}}

Mass of liquid = 1.64 \textrm{ g/mL}\times 50 \textrm{ mL} = 82 \textrm{ g}

Mass of 50 mL liquid = 82 g
